qq免费名片十万赞,快手卡盟三块一万粉丝_鑫鑫快手业务

核心内容摘要

qq免费名片十万赞长尾关键词排名积累到一定体量后,会形成流量集群,反向提升网站整体权重,推动核心大词排名稳步向前。

图片 图片 图片 图片

开发友链平台必备的编程语言及开发环境解析

在当今互联网高速发展的时代,友链平台成为网站之间建立联系和提升SEO排名的重要工具。一个高效且稳定的友链平台,离不开先进的技术支持和合理的开发环境配置。本文将围绕开发友链平台所需的编程语言选择、开发环境搭建及其技术要点,进行详尽的解析。帮助开发者全面理解和掌握实现友链平台的核心技术,确保项目从规划到实施都能高效推进,满足搜索引擎和用户的双重需求。

一、友链平台开发的技术需求分析

友链平台主要功能涉及友链申请、审核、展示、管理及统计等模块,这些功能对系统的安全性、稳定性和用户体验提出了较高要求。因此,开发这样的系统需要满足以下几点技术需求:

  • 性能稳定:系统应能承载大量用户访问和友链请求,保持响应速度与服务稳定。
  • 数据安全性:用户提交的友链信息需保护,防止数据泄露和恶意篡改。
  • 易扩展性:随着友链数量增加,系统架构应支持灵活扩展和功能升级。
  • SEO友好:网站页面结构需合乎搜索引擎爬虫抓取规则,提升友链内容的展现效果。

针对这些需求,选择合适的编程语言和开发环境至关重要。

二、开发友链平台必备的编程语言

合理选择编程语言不仅提升开发效率,还能优化系统性能。通常适合开发友链平台的语言包括:

  • 后端语言:
    • PHP:成熟的Web开发语言,拥有丰富的开源框架(如Laravel、ThinkPHP),适合快速搭建高效的内容管理系统,社区支持力度大,易于集成第三方SEO优化插件。
    • Python:以Django、Flask等框架闻名,Python代码简洁、易读,便于后期维护。Django自带后台管理和安全机制,适合构建复杂的友链管理系统。
    • Node.js:基于JavaScript,适合构建高并发、实时响应的系统。用Express等框架搭建API简单快捷,适合异步处理友链请求。
    • Java:性能稳定,适合大型企业级应用。Spring Boot等框架支持模块化开发和微服务架构,适合后期系统规模扩展。
  • 前端语言:
    • 前端框架:如Vue.js、React或Angular可帮助构建动态和高性能的用户界面,提升用户体验。

三、推荐的开发环境配置

开发友链平台建议搭配合适的开发环境配置,以保证开发流程顺畅,并便于系统维护升级。

  • 操作系统:推荐使用Linux(如Ubuntu、CentOS)服务器,因其稳定、安全且与主流Web服务器软件的兼容性强。
  • Web服务器:Apache或Nginx,Nginx以高性能、高并发处理能力著称,适合生产环境。
  • 数据库:MySQL、PostgreSQL或MongoDB,根据数据结构复杂度选择关系型或非关系型数据库。MySQL在PHP环境中应用广泛,性能可靠。
  • 开发工具:集成开发环境(IDE)如VS Code、PhpStorm、PyCharm等,可提高代码编写效率和调试能力。
  • 版本控制:使用Git进行代码管理,结合GitHub、GitLab或码云等平台,实现多人协作。
  • 依赖管理工具:Composer(PHP)、pip(Python)、npm(Node.js)能够简化第三方库的安装和管理。

四、友链平台开发中的核心技术点

除了基本的编程语言和环境配置,友链平台开发中还需要关注以下技术点:

  • SEO技术实现:包括合理设置URL结构、页面Meta标签(标题、关键词、描述)优化、网站地图(sitemap.xml)生成及robots.txt设置,保证搜索引擎友好。
  • 安全防护机制:防止SQL注入、XSS攻击及CSRF攻击。采用参数化查询、前端输入过滤和权限验证机制保障系统安全。
  • 数据缓存技术:通过Redis或Memcached等缓存技术减少数据库压力,提高响应速度,提升用户体验。
  • 响应式设计与跨浏览器兼容:保证平台在PC端和移动端均能流畅访问,并支持主流浏览器,拓展用户覆盖面。
  • 操作后台管理系统:为站长提供便捷的友链审核、发布、分类管理及统计功能,提高运营效率。

五、常见开发框架推荐

针对友链平台开发,以下几种框架值得推荐:

  • Laravel(PHP):强调代码优雅易维护,具备丰富的生态系统,内置强大的路由、ORM和安全功能,适合快速构建友链平台。
  • Django(Python):提供“电池自带”理念,具备完备的后台管理、安全认证和ORM,适合稳定的企业级友链平台建设。
  • Express(Node.js):极简灵活,适合构建高性能API服务,便于前后端分离开发。
  • Vue.js / React:结合前端单页应用框架,增强页面交互体验,搭配RESTful API实现数据交互。

六、开发流程与SEO优化建议

友链平台开发建议遵循以下流程:

  • 需求分析:准确梳理平台功能,明确友链管理和展示的业务逻辑。
  • 原型设计:制作清晰的界面和交互草图,确保用户体验和SEO要求。
  • 环境搭建:根据选定语言和框架配置开发环境。
  • 编码实现:模块化开发功能,重点关注SEO相关标签和页面结构。
  • 测试优化:进行功能测试、安全测试和性能测试,确保系统稳定运行。
  • 部署上线:选择合适的服务器环境,并配置HTTPS保障数据传输安全。
  • SEO监控与维护:利用百度站长工具、Google Search Console等分析收录情况,持续优化。

同时,友链平台应充分利用结构化数据(schema.org等)标记丰富的内容,提升搜索引擎展示效果;定期更新友链资源,保持平台活力,有利于搜索引擎排名提升。

开发友链平台的总结归纳

开发一个优秀的友链平台,编程语言与开发环境的合理选择是基础。PHP、Python、Node.js等语言具备强大的生态支持,配合Linux服务器、MySQL数据库及高性能的Web服务器,能够构建稳定、安全且高效的系统。采用现代开发框架(如Laravel、Django、Express)能够加快开发进度,提高代码质量。与此同时,遵循SEO最佳实践,注重安全防护及用户体验,将极大提升平台的竞争力和搜索引擎友好度。

开发友链平台必备的编程语言及开发环境解析

在当今互联网高速发展的时代,友链平台成为网站之间建立联系和提升SEO排名的重要工具。一个高效且稳定的友链平台,离不开先进的技术支持和合理的开发环境配置。本文将围绕开发友链平台所需的编程语言选择、开发环境搭建及其技术要点,进行详尽的解析。帮助开发者全面理解和掌握实现友链平台的核心技术,确保项目从规划到实施都能高效推进,满足搜索引擎和用户的双重需求。

一、友链平台开发的技术需求分析

友链平台主要功能涉及友链申请、审核、展示、管理及统计等模块,这些功能对系统的安全性、稳定性和用户体验提出了较高要求。因此,开发这样的系统需要满足以下几点技术需求:

  • 性能稳定:系统应能承载大量用户访问和友链请求,保持响应速度与服务稳定。
  • 数据安全性:用户提交的友链信息需保护,防止数据泄露和恶意篡改。
  • 易扩展性:随着友链数量增加,系统架构应支持灵活扩展和功能升级。
  • SEO友好:网站页面结构需合乎搜索引擎爬虫抓取规则,提升友链内容的展现效果。

针对这些需求,选择合适的编程语言和开发环境至关重要。

二、开发友链平台必备的编程语言

合理选择编程语言不仅提升开发效率,还能优化系统性能。通常适合开发友链平台的语言包括:

  • 后端语言:
    • PHP:成熟的Web开发语言,拥有丰富的开源框架(如Laravel、ThinkPHP),适合快速搭建高效的内容管理系统,社区支持力度大,易于集成第三方SEO优化插件。
    • Python:以Django、Flask等框架闻名,Python代码简洁、易读,便于后期维护。Django自带后台管理和安全机制,适合构建复杂的友链管理系统。
    • Node.js:基于JavaScript,适合构建高并发、实时响应的系统。用Express等框架搭建API简单快捷,适合异步处理友链请求。
    • Java:性能稳定,适合大型企业级应用。Spring Boot等框架支持模块化开发和微服务架构,适合后期系统规模扩展。
  • 前端语言:
    • 前端框架:如Vue.js、React或Angular可帮助构建动态和高性能的用户界面,提升用户体验。

三、推荐的开发环境配置

开发友链平台建议搭配合适的开发环境配置,以保证开发流程顺畅,并便于系统维护升级。

  • 操作系统:推荐使用Linux(如Ubuntu、CentOS)服务器,因其稳定、安全且与主流Web服务器软件的兼容性强。
  • Web服务器:Apache或Nginx,Nginx以高性能、高并发处理能力著称,适合生产环境。
  • 数据库:MySQL、PostgreSQL或MongoDB,根据数据结构复杂度选择关系型或非关系型数据库。MySQL在PHP环境中应用广泛,性能可靠。
  • 开发工具:集成开发环境(IDE)如VS Code、PhpStorm、PyCharm等,可提高代码编写效率和调试能力。
  • 版本控制:使用Git进行代码管理,结合GitHub、GitLab或码云等平台,实现多人协作。
  • 依赖管理工具:Composer(PHP)、pip(Python)、npm(Node.js)能够简化第三方库的安装和管理。

四、友链平台开发中的核心技术点

除了基本的编程语言和环境配置,友链平台开发中还需要关注以下技术点:

  • SEO技术实现:包括合理设置URL结构、页面Meta标签(标题、关键词、描述)优化、网站地图(sitemap.xml)生成及robots.txt设置,保证搜索引擎友好。
  • 安全防护机制:防止SQL注入、XSS攻击及CSRF攻击。采用参数化查询、前端输入过滤和权限验证机制保障系统安全。
  • 数据缓存技术:通过Redis或Memcached等缓存技术减少数据库压力,提高响应速度,提升用户体验。
  • 响应式设计与跨浏览器兼容:保证平台在PC端和移动端均能流畅访问,并支持主流浏览器,拓展用户覆盖面。
  • 操作后台管理系统:为站长提供便捷的友链审核、发布、分类管理及统计功能,提高运营效率。

五、常见开发框架推荐

针对友链平台开发,以下几种框架值得推荐:

  • Laravel(PHP):强调代码优雅易维护,具备丰富的生态系统,内置强大的路由、ORM和安全功能,适合快速构建友链平台。
  • Django(Python):提供“电池自带”理念,具备完备的后台管理、安全认证和ORM,适合稳定的企业级友链平台建设。
  • Express(Node.js):极简灵活,适合构建高性能API服务,便于前后端分离开发。
  • Vue.js / React:结合前端单页应用框架,增强页面交互体验,搭配RESTful API实现数据交互。

六、开发流程与SEO优化建议

友链平台开发建议遵循以下流程:

  • 需求分析:准确梳理平台功能,明确友链管理和展示的业务逻辑。
  • 原型设计:制作清晰的界面和交互草图,确保用户体验和SEO要求。
  • 环境搭建:根据选定语言和框架配置开发环境。
  • 编码实现:模块化开发功能,重点关注SEO相关标签和页面结构。
  • 测试优化:进行功能测试、安全测试和性能测试,确保系统稳定运行。
  • 部署上线:选择合适的服务器环境,并配置HTTPS保障数据传输安全。
  • SEO监控与维护:利用百度站长工具、Google Search Console等分析收录情况,持续优化。

同时,友链平台应充分利用结构化数据(schema.org等)标记丰富的内容,提升搜索引擎展示效果;定期更新友链资源,保持平台活力,有利于搜索引擎排名提升。

开发友链平台的总结归纳

开发一个优秀的友链平台,编程语言与开发环境的合理选择是基础。PHP、Python、Node.js等语言具备强大的生态支持,配合Linux服务器、MySQL数据库及高性能的Web服务器,能够构建稳定、安全且高效的系统。采用现代开发框架(如Laravel、Django、Express)能够加快开发进度,提高代码质量。与此同时,遵循SEO最佳实践,注重安全防护及用户体验,将极大提升平台的竞争力和搜索引擎友好度。

优化核心要点

qq免费名片十万赞,快手卡盟三块一万粉丝_鑫鑫快手业务

蜘蛛池站群内容优化助推网站权重快速提升

qq免费名片十万赞长尾关键词排名积累到一定体量后,会形成流量集群,反向提升网站整体权重,推动核心大词排名稳步向前。 - 本文详细介绍了有哪些蜘蛛池开发语言推荐?

关键词:轻松写好SEO优化报告,提升网站排名不再难